Congratulations! I am happy to hear they are already sending out admissions, sometimes they are notorious for being late to the game with offers ( like early/mid April). I also applied for MAGG and will be crossing my fingers today/tomorrow to hear from them.

'Full funding' from BSIA generally means that in exchange for approx. 10 hours/week of RA-style work with CIGI, your tuition is covered (sometimes + a lil extra, that bit is unclear to me). Anyway, congrats - it's an awesome program and likely my top choice! Is it your top choice as well?

Do they give TAships once you start courses in the University? My funding is kind of underwhelming. I haven't received any TA or RA, considering I have no background can't complain. But all scholarships combined, I have 14k (available only for the first year, nothing on second year was included). So I was wondering if you can personally go and apply for a TA or RA once you finish a semester or two.

You can definitely apply in September, they send out an email. PhD students are the ones with guaranteed TAships and depending on how big your cohort is you are almost always guaranteed a TA position as a graduate student. They almost always need TA's so they typically see grad students as qualified lol.
